"Arrow" Season 2 continues to get more exciting for the fans of the DC Comics adaptation. Episode 20, "Seeing Red," is centred on Colton Haynes as Roy Harper, aka DC Comics' Red Hood. In the comics, Roy is also known as "Speedy." In The CW, however, Thea Queen (Willa Holland) is Speedy. What happens to them when Mirakuru takes control of Roy? ‘Divergent’ Star Shailene Woodley of ‘Sheo’ Shares Recipe of Her Secret Healthy Tea Crafted in a Slow Cooker [PHOTOS]

Shailene Woodley has a secret recipe for her favourite tea and she literally picks the ingredients herself and prepares it in a slow cooker. The ‘Divergent’ star, who is linked to co-star Theo James, loves to brew a tea with medicinal properties using chaga (a kind of wild mushroom that grows on the trunk of the birch tree). According to “Natural Health Magazine,” Shailene herself rummages chaga for her tea.

Courteney Cox on 'FRIENDS' Reunion: 'Not Going to Happen'

Internationally known for her role as Monica on one of TV's longest running series "FRIENDS," Courteney Cox revealed on Monday, April 21, that the show's potential reunion is not going to happen. On her latest interview on "The Late Show With David Letterman" Cox squashed all hopes of "Friends" fans when she said, "It's not gonna happen."
